HMRC is the UK’s tax, payments and customs authority and we have a vital purpose: we collect the money that pays for the UK’s public services and helps provide families and individuals with targeted financial support. Covert Operations, Digital Exploitation (CODE) sits within HMRC’s wider Fraud Investigation Service (FIS) responsible for the department’s civil and criminal investigation work. FIS ensures that HMRC has an effective approach to investigating the most serious tax evasion and fraud. Working across Law Enforcement and government, CODE provides investigative tools and covert techniques to front-line investigations, and works with key partners to develop and provide access to new technology and systems which will enable investigators to respond to serious and complex tax evasion and crime. Sensitive Collection is one of HMRC’s most cutting edge, fast-paced and impactful tools, working closely with CODE Covert and Digital Operations teams, other Law Enforcement Agencies (LEAs) and the UK Intelligence Community (UKIC). Targeted Interception (TI) as a key component of Sensitive Collection, provides both FIS investigation and RIS intelligence teams with interdiction and evidential gathering opportunities gained through the lawful acquisition of criminals’ communications. TI also provides an unparalleled insight into criminal intent and behaviour, which is used to drive tactical operational activity and inform the strategic response across all aspects of HMRC related serious crime. The role requires working flexibly around the dynamic needs of the business to ensure meaningful sensitive intelligence delivery, and provision of time critical advice and direction to serious crime investigations. 2023/24 is an exciting time for HMRC Sensitive Collection as we develop new capabilities and methodologies in a fast-changing digital world. Sensitive Collection is undertaking a transformation project that will enable us to evolve into a highly skilled, cross-functional, Tier 3 Sensitive Communications Exploitation Business Unit that can rapidly acquire, process, and derive intelligence value from a range of sensitive communications sources.
